Output 5268b566ee501aac22a19eee5a3dd892180d14e3cb7659727c90d50d489a94de:28

value
558200
script pubkey
OP_0 OP_PUSHBYTES_20 42f0f03130400675d6e408f565dfaed90e8cc5fe
address
bc1qgtc0qvfsgqr8t4hypr6kthawmy8ge307lyt0e3
transaction
5268b566ee501aac22a19eee5a3dd892180d14e3cb7659727c90d50d489a94de
confirmations
250437
spent
true